Start FIDO Implementation Using LoginRadius Admin Console

1
Navigate to Authentication > Authentication Configuration > Passkeys.
2
Toggle the Passkey Authentication switch to Enable.
3
Click Update to apply; Touch ID is supported via this FIDO2/WebAuthn framework.
